The use of the form dates back to ancient mesopotamia ca. 690 BC in the form of hexagonal
shaped cuneiform of the Assyrian king Sennacherib´s annals, and is one of the first humans
found to utilize hexagonal shapes.
The series comes in natural solid pine or burned pine that gives it its character and tactility in
the visible wavy woodgrains.

Sizar Alexis is a Swedish-Iraqi product and furniture designer that experiments
with objects that display serenity through geometrical shapes, while
remaining robust in volume. His trademark style is built on creating objects
bear a strong character, accomplished through the use of raw and imperfect
